Escape the city and discover the breathtaking beauty of Morocco's Middle Atlas Mountains. Visit the alpine charm of Ifrane—the 'Switzerland of Morocco'—encounter wild Barbary macaques in the cedar forests of Azrou, and soak in the natural beauty of mountain springs and Berber villages.
